Urban Homesteading Assistance Board (UHAB)
Industry: Non-profit organization
DescriptionThe Urban Homesteading Assistance Board, or UHAB, is a non-profit organization in New York City that helps create and support self-help housing. UHAB works with residents to acquire, rehabilitate and manage their apartments. Founded: 1974 Headquarters: New York City, NY Motto: Co-ops for Communities Budget: 5.4 million USD Staff: 65
